Your Trucking Injury Questions, Answered

How are truck accident cases different from other motor vehicle accident cases?

  • What should I do after a truck accident in Georgia?

    Seek medical attention, report the crash, and contact an experienced trucking injury attorney to protect your rights.

  • Who is typically liable in a truck accident?

    Liability may rest with the driver, trucking company, maintenance contractor, or even the manufacturer of a defective truck part.

  • What damages can I recover?

    You may be eligible for compensation covering hospital bills, rehabilitation, lost earnings, pain, suffering, and future care needs.

  • Is there a deadline to file my claim?

    Yes — in Georgia, trucking injury lawsuits must be filed within two years of the accident.

  • Can I sue if I’m partially at fault?

    Possibly. Georgia’s modified comparative negligence rule allows recovery if you’re less than 50% responsible for the crash.
